About
Jacky Murat is a trail runner from Réunion Island, the French volcanic territory in the Indian Ocean that is home to one of ultrarunning's most storied races, the Grand Raid de la Réunion (La Diagonale des Fous). He is remembered for the controversial 1994 edition of the race: Murat crossed the finish line more than an hour ahead of the field, but organisers ruled he had missed two mandatory checkpoints and disqualified him, awarding the win to Philippe Marie-Louise instead — a decision that remains a point of local legend on the island. Murat went on to found and preside over the Association d'Athlétisme de Jacky Murat (AAJM), which has organised trail races in Réunion's volcanic terrain since the early 1990s, including the Transvolcano Piton de la Fournaise, cementing his role as a builder of the island's running culture beyond his own competitive career.
